The CSGO Workshop is a treasure trove of user-generated content, allowing players to explore a variety of maps created by the community. To start, launch CSGO and navigate to the Community tab on the main menu. Once there, click on Workshop to access the extensive library of maps. Use the search bar to filter results based on popularity, ratings, or tags that cater to specific gameplay styles. You can also browse collections created by other users to find maps that pique your interest.

In the vibrant world of CSGO, maps serve as the canvas for creativity and competition. What truly makes a map stand out is its unique design elements and gameplay mechanics. Maps that incorporate varying terrains and structures not only enhance the visual experience but also challenge players’ strategies. For example, those that include vertical spaces or intricate pathways encourage dynamic gameplay and foster innovative tactics. Community feedback plays a crucial role in this process, as maps that resonate with players are often iterated upon and improved, leading to a polished final product that can become iconic.
Another essential aspect is the thematic consistency that ties the map together. Successful user-created maps often tell a story or evoke a particular atmosphere that immerses players in their unique environments. Factors such as lighting, sound design, and texturing contribute to this experience, making players feel as though they are part of a bigger narrative. Engaging a community with features like open beta testing also allows map creators to refine their work based on real-time player interactions and preferences, ensuring that the final product is not only visually appealing but also deeply enjoyable to play.
